Grammy Winner Ella Mai Lands in South Africa Ahead of Highly Anticipated Shows
Grammy-winning British singer Ella Mai has arrived in South Africa, building excitement ahead of her highly anticipated live performances this weekend.
The R&B star, best known for her global hit “Boo’d Up,” is set to perform at the Sun City Superbowl during the Konka Kulture Weekend on April 25, followed by a second show at the Grand Arena, GrandWest on April 26.
Event organisers Vertex Events SA shared footage of her arrival at O.R. Tambo International Airport, where she appeared relaxed as she made her way through the terminal alongside her team.
Fans can expect performances of some of her biggest hits, including “Boo’d Up” and “Trip,” as well as music from her latest project Do You Still Love Me? (DYSLM), which features tracks like “Things” and “Tell Her.”
Since her breakthrough in 2014, Ella Mai has built a strong international following with her smooth vocals and emotionally driven songwriting. Her hit single “Boo’d Up” earned her a Grammy Award for Best R&B Song in 2019, cementing her place as a leading voice in modern R&B.
The upcoming concerts are expected to draw large crowds, with fans eager to experience her live performances in an intimate setting.
She will also share the stage with top South African acts, including Sjava, Nasty C, Zee Nxumalo, Uncle Waffles, Oscar Mbo, and Scorpion Kings.
